RLH was a Fun One

4 Rating: 4, Useful: 5 / 5
Date: November 04, 2002
Author: Amazon User

I don't want to argue with other reviewers, but I thought the game was rather easy to complete. Now that doesn't mean that I didn't like the game. I thought the graphics were incredible and the storyline held true to most Sci-fi horror games (save yourself and the human race). Unlike other games, the voice overs/acting was very well done and in general the whole game played out like a movie, which I liked. The Music was good and the sound effects did their job. I definitely jumped out of my shoes a couple of times. Plenty of weapons to choose from, most of them needed to be powered up with items you find during gameplay (some had two different types of triggers). I didn't notice the mosters getting smarter on their own, the game made them harder to beat, but they didn't really change their patterns of attack. The bosses were not overly difficult to beat once you learned their moves and because the game gives you so much health and healing powers, I hardly ever had to continue the game. The puzzles aren't impossible to solve, but you find yourself having to look around for the clue quite a bit. I didn't like the fact that once you completed a section of the game, there was no going back to maybe look over the area more closely (makes you wonder what you left behind). There are some blantant uses of the 'F'-word (4 or 5, I think) as well as many of the other 'more acceptable' profanities, so that's your call, they're your kids!! My advice is to rent it for 5 days, two hours a day should be more than enough time to finish this one off. Replay value doesn't seem to be too high, I am already looking forward to playing something else. Recommend playing this one, just not buying!!
